Transaction f074436583dae85349a2ae645d74df505291708883d730502a0094dd222f63ec

1 Input
2 Outputs
  • f074436583dae85349a2ae645d74df505291708883d730502a0094dd222f63ec:0
  • value  110000000
    address  mpEPsVvA56vgNusjpQYDCkvxbei9KCJ9MW
  • f074436583dae85349a2ae645d74df505291708883d730502a0094dd222f63ec:1
  • value  53343493686
    address  2Mtwp4PU75LPWZJ3SkojE195jfeY2FFR21u